What is the difference between the pipe types you stock?
PVC is used for condensate drains and for venting high-efficiency furnaces. Black iron and CSST are gas. Conduit protects electrical. They are not interchangeable and each has its own code requirements.
Can I use PVC for a furnace flue?
Only on a condensing (90%+) furnace that is designed for it, and only the pipe schedule and material the manufacturer specifies. An 80% furnace vents into metal B-vent, never plastic - the flue gas is far too hot.
What size condensate drain line?
3/4 inch is the residential standard. Give it a consistent slope, put a cleanout at the top so it can be vacuumed, and fit a trap where the equipment calls for one.
Who can run gas pipe?
In Texas a homeowner may work on their own home under the homeowner exemption; that does not extend to doing it for someone else. Gas work is unforgiving and leak testing is not optional. If you are unsure, this is one to hand off.
